Title: | Solar cell simulation based on nano-structure | Authors: | Yip, Catherine Li Yin. | Keywords: | DRNTU::Engineering::Electrical and electronic engineering::Nanoelectronics | Issue Date: | 2010 | Abstract: | There is a strong demand in renewable energy and hence nowadays more and more projects are implementing renewable energy technologies in their project, for example solar energy. Solar panel has been used for generating free solar energy and solar cell is one of the most promising clean energy sources. Many companies of the industries are focusing on high efficiency solar cells which can generate electricity at higher efficiencies with the most cost efficient technologies. Therefore there is a need to improve the efficiency of solar panel in order to product the maximum clean energy with the minimum cost. Today nano structure has been widely investigated to improve its efficiency. In this project, it is proposed to develop nano structures on silicon wafer. With the control of the etch timing as well as reactive ion etching time, it can have various size and length of nano-wires. | URI: | http://hdl.handle.net/10356/40769 | Schools: | School of Electrical and Electronic Engineering | Rights: | Nanyang Technological University | Fulltext Permission: | restricted | Fulltext Availability: | With Fulltext |
